首页 / 服务器推荐 / 正文
CDN与DNS加速技术解析,dnspod cdn加速

Time:2024年10月24日 Read:21 评论:42 作者:y21dr45

随着互联网的迅速发展,用户对网络服务的要求越来越高,在众多网络技术中,CDN(内容分发网络)和DNS(域名系统)是提高网站访问速度和稳定性的重要手段,本文将深入探讨CDN和DNS加速技术的工作原理及其优势,帮助读者更好地理解和应用这些技术。

CDN与DNS加速技术解析,dnspod cdn加速

1、CDN概述

CDN是一种通过在多个地理位置部署服务器节点,将网站内容缓存到离用户最近的节点上,从而减少数据传输距离和时间的技术,它主要解决的是网站访问速度慢、带宽消耗大等问题。

2、CDN的工作原理

CDN的核心思想是将内容推送到离用户更近的位置,当用户访问某个网站时,首先会向DNS服务器请求IP地址,DNS服务器会返回该网站的主服务器IP地址,用户会向这个IP地址发起请求,但实际的数据请求会转发到离用户最近的CDN节点上,CDN节点会将数据缓存起来,下次用户访问时直接从缓存中获取数据,从而大大提高了访问速度。

3、CDN的优势

- 提高访问速度:通过将内容缓存到离用户更近的位置,减少了数据传输距离和时间,提高了访问速度。

- 减轻主服务器压力:CDN节点可以分担主服务器的负载,降低主服务器的压力。

- 提高可用性:CDN节点分布在不同地区,即使某个节点出现问题,其他节点仍然可以提供服务,保证了服务的可用性。

- 节省带宽成本:通过缓存数据,减少了对原始服务器的带宽需求,降低了带宽成本。

DNS(域名系统)加速

1、DNS概述

DNS是一种用于将域名转换为IP地址的系统,它的主要功能是解析域名和提供反向域名解析服务,传统的DNS查询过程较慢,可能导致用户体验不佳,DNS加速技术应运而生。

2、DNS的工作原理

当用户输入一个网址时,浏览器首先会向本地DNS服务器请求域名解析,如果本地DNS服务器无法解析该域名,它会向根DNS服务器请求解析,根DNS服务器会返回一系列顶级域的DNS服务器地址,本地DNS服务器再向这些服务器请求解析,顶级域的DNS服务器会返回相应的IP地址,整个过程可能耗时较长,影响用户体验。

3、DNS加速的优势

- 提高查询速度:通过缓存域名解析结果,减少了对根DNS服务器的查询次数,提高了查询速度。

- 减轻根DNS服务器压力:DNS加速技术可以分担根DNS服务器的压力,降低其负载。

- 提高可用性:通过分布式部署多个DNS服务器,即使某个服务器出现问题,其他服务器仍然可以提供服务,保证了服务的可用性。

- 节省带宽成本:通过缓存域名解析结果,减少了对原始根DNS服务器的带宽需求,降低了带宽成本。

CDN与DNS加速的结合应用

在实际的网络环境中,CDN和DNS加速往往结合使用,以实现最佳的性能优化效果,一个网站可以通过部署CDN来缓存静态资源(如图片、视频等),同时使用DNS加速技术来解析域名,这样,用户可以在最短的时间内获得所需的资源和服务。

案例分析

以某知名视频网站为例,该网站采用了CDN和DNS加速技术后,访问速度得到了显著提升。

- 在未采用CDN之前,用户的观看体验较差,缓冲时间长;采用CDN后,由于静态资源被缓存到了离用户更近的节点上,缓冲时间大大缩短。

- 在未采用DNS加速之前,用户访问网站时需要多次向根DNS服务器请求解析域名;采用DNS加速后,由于域名解析结果被缓存了起来,用户的查询速度得到了提高。

标签: cdn dns加速 
排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1